Why Most People Fail in Farmasi

Joining Farmasi is not rocket science. You enter your local website, scroll down to the “BECOME A FARMASI INFLUENCER” link and start the registration process. You get to also choose your so-called sponsor, which is ultimately a person helping you out with the entire process. Your sponsor is also responsible for sending you news and offers and guiding you daily.

Once you have completed the registration form, you are a Farmasi influencer. But not officially yet! As in every business, you need to meet certain requirements. In this case, you buy one of the starter packs, or if you already use the products, you start getting sales and achieve monthly goals. That is done via collecting points and meeting monthly requirements.

You don’t need a warehouse, you don’t need to be famous, and you don’t need thousands of followers. However, the way you start and position yourself from the beginning is crucial and will decide whether you fail or succeed.

Stop Treating It Like “Easy Money”

Working as a Farmasi ambassador is not easy at all. You won’t see the money right away. Unless your family and friends gather those 200 points (the first 3% you need to achieve) to qualify for your commission. From there, you need to hit at least 3% and above every single month! You are, after all, working for commissions, not a salary.

Many people join because someone sold them a fantasy about passive income, a luxury lifestyle, quick success with your feet up and instant team growth. Again, unless you are transferring an existing customer base or team, it will take you on average 3-6 months to build a steady income with Farmasi. Farmasi is still a business, and businesses take time.

You are, however, starting strong, backed up by a powerful house that provides support, guidance, and motivation. Depending on your sponsor, there is normally zero pressure in hitting monthly targets. But it might feel demotivating when you spend a whole month posting on your socials and working hard, only to miss ten points and get paid.

Which is why I advise planning a whole month, from the content you plan to post, through the budget and the monthly goal you set up. If you think you won’t hit the target, choose the lowest possible one, even if it’s only 0%. At least you will still qualify for the initial programme (75 points).

Let me give you an example from my own Farmasi business. When I started for the first time, I went straight for the recruitment. People were not only super sceptical but also talked badly about me behind my back. Then I started again, focusing on products and sales. But again, with the wrong attitude and unrealistic goals.

I spent so much of my own money just to get those first 200 points. Begged my family to place an order. And then I felt empty. Because it felt like all for nothing. I was barely reaching monthly goals and had no support, because my sponsor only cared about numbers and performance. I would find a nasty and sarcastic message in my DMs every time I did not meet my monthly goals.

Or I would receive motivational, sugar-coated messages saying if I reach my goal and bring in more people, they will pay for my dinner, spa or new dress. Believe me, I hated that period of my life with passion. The third time is the charm, right? I did not give up. I started again, this time in a different country with a fresh mindset.

But I was smarter and put others before my own ego and pride. I knew I wouldn’t meet the monthly goals right away. I also knew people wouldn’t just place tonnes of orders because I posted one reel. So I worked hard for 4 months, posting stories and reels daily, talking to people, sharing my experience, knowledge about products and my excitement.

The first 2 months can be rough because you don’t see any results, you spend your own money, and the community is quiet. But if you remain patient and resilient, by your fourth month people will start to recognise you as the authority in the industry. You actually know and use the products; some people got curious, and some even placed orders with your discount.

And so it begins to snowball. If you push past those first 6 months, something wonderful happens. People no longer cringe over your Instagram or TikTok posts. They now come to you, seeing you as the expert for Farmasi products, placing orders every month, listening to your advice, and even joining your team. That feeling is truly worth it.

When I joined Farmasi for the third time, I stayed for good. It finally worked, but in my first week I only browsed the catalogue, learnt about products and wrote down whole pages about routines, marketing strategies and ideal audiences. I searched for people in my immediate location who already enjoy beauty and good deals.

But I did not cold-message them. I never do that. I simply added them, followed them just like they followed me, and got to know them. After months of enjoying my content, they messaged ME. That is a huge difference when it comes to networking and sales. You want people to trust you and come to you with specific needs and requests. And then you help them to fulfil those.

That one person who messaged me then told their friends and family, shared their experience, reviews and excitement, and got me even more stable clients. Everything I described above…I mean it. FAQ: How to Start Farmasi From Scratch in 2026

Is Farmasi worth joining in 2026?

Farmasi can be worth joining if you enjoy beauty, content creation, and building trust online. People who succeed usually treat it like a long-term business instead of expecting quick money.

How much does it cost to start Farmasi?

The starting cost depends on your country and chosen starter kit. Most people begin with a relatively low investment compared to traditional businesses, which is why Farmasi appeals to beginners and stay-at-home mothers.

Why do most people fail in Farmasi?

Most people fail because they expect fast success, rely only on motivation, constantly pressure people to buy, or copy outdated MLM tactics. Lack of consistency and authenticity are two of the biggest reasons people quit early.

Do you need a large social media following to succeed with Farmasi?

No. A small but engaged audience is often more powerful than a large audience that doesn’t trust you. Many successful creators grow slowly by sharing honest lifestyle, beauty, and routine content consistently.

Can you build a Farmasi business while working another job?

Yes, and in many cases it actually helps your credibility. Keeping another income source can reduce pressure, help you grow more authentically, and make your recommendations feel more trustworthy to your audience.
